"Adventures in Wallypug-Land" by G. E. (George Edward) Farrow is a comical early 20th-century children's book that tells the story of a kid's visit to the weird land of Why, which is run by the kind Wallypug. In this magical place, the main character meets all sorts of funny creatures and learns about their odd ways of life. It all starts when the main character gets invited to Why by the Wallypug himself. After a funny trip that involves a strange package, the main character arrives in Why, a place where animals talk and act like people. From meeting a grumpy crow to an offended pelican, the main character is introduced to the funny and strange world of the Wallypug's court, promising even more adventures.
